Analysis

Mongolia recorded 96.3% for coverage in 2nd quintile (%) - all social assistance -rural in 2020.

That represents a change of up 2.4% on the previous year and down 0.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, coverage in 2nd quintile (%) - all social assistance -rural in Mongolia peaked at 100.0% in 2012 and was at its lowest, 87.7%, in 2009.

That places Mongolia 5th out of 36 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the top quarter.
